Your Role:
The Information Architecture Governance Advisor owns the design and implementation of an enterprise information model. Establishes and carries out enterprise data and information architecture policies, standards, and processes according to guidelines. Is responsible for structuring, organizing, and communicating information in a way that makes it easy for business users to find, navigate, and understand. Champions and facilitates the review of data-related changes across the organization.

Works with business partners and Information Technology (IT) partners to drive consensus around how data should be structured.

This business-focused role will reside on the Enterprise Data Governance team but will be expected to closely interact with other architects and data modelers within the IT division.

Your Work:
· Define criteria and controls for an authoritative data source (ADS)
Lead the design and implementation of information modeling practices for the enterprise

Define data and information architecture related standards and guidelines

Coordinate and facilitate the review of data-related changes from an enterprise perspective

Organize data within domains and sub-domains to enhance the ability to find, govern, and utilize data across the enterprise

Enhance the company’s data governance platform to include data and information architecture components, definitions, and relationships

Support enterprise data strategy and data governance programs by providing a structured approach to architectural decision-making, ensuring changes are evaluated based on their impact across the enterprise

Identify and mitigate risks associated with architectural decisions and implementations

Establish guidelines and standards to minimize risks while ensuring compliance with regulations and policies

Act as liaison between business and IT to translate business data requirements into logical data architecture design

Engage in the development of policies, standards and procedures and coordinate with stakeholders through the approval process

Ensure compliance with established standards for development and management of data Ensure compliance to data-related regulatory rules

Perform regular peer review of information models used across the enterprise
